What is Benchmarking?
Benchmarking is a systematic process of comparing a company’s performance against industry leaders or direct competitors to uncover insights for superior performance. It involves analysing processes and practices that lead to exceptional outcomes in other organizations.

Benefits of Benchmarking

  • Identifies performance gaps and areas for improvement
  • Sets realistic goals and strategies
  • Enhances operational efficiency and cost savings
  • Encourages innovation and learning
  • Supports strategic decision-making

Types of Benchmarking :

Performance Benchmarking

We compare products and services with those of target firms to assess competitive position.

Internal Benchmarking

We compare teams or departments within the same company.

Financial Benchmarking

We strengthen financial state through financial analysis.

Best Practice Benchmarking

We compare new methods and practices for performing efficient processes.

Competitive Benchmarking

We directly compare performance against best competitors.

Product Benchmarking

We help design new products or upgrade current one.

Strategic Benchmarking

We compare long-term decisions and actions undertaken by other organizations.

Functional Benchmarking

We compare functions against non-competitive organizations.
